I have a KuKirin G4 (60V) with about 3,600–3,700 km on it. I’ve owned it since June 2025. A few months ago I rode it in extremely heavy storm conditions (Ireland — torrential rain). After that, the scooter started cutting out and eventually the controller failed due to water damage. I replaced it with a brand-new genuine G4 controller (not programmable). Since then, the power delivery has been strange: * From full battery down to around 4–6 bars (display only shows 10 bars, no voltage or %), the scooter feels weak — acceleration and top speed feel more like a G2. * Once it drops below a certain bar level, it suddenly “unlocks” and delivers full G4 performance. * When unlocked, it pulls very hard and can hit 65–68 km/h on flat ground (I weigh 82 kg). * The power is completely consistent once unlocked — no surging or fluctuation. Originally, it would unlock around 4 bars. Recently, it unlocked around 6 bars instead. It does not show voltage, only battery bars. Motor feels strong once unlocked. No random cut-outs anymore. I’m trying to figure out: * Is this a voltage sag / battery internal resistance issue? * BMS behavior? * High-current wiring resistance from water exposure? * Or something specific to G4 controllers? Has anyone experienced similar behavior where full power only becomes available at lower battery levels?
